Changed out the cupholders just now. 1C3Z3613562AAA (parchment) $36 with shipping from partsguyed Took all of 30 seconds to change. Here is the before and after pic to show the difference. The new is slightly deeper than the rear cupholders. Hopefully won't be bathing the interior with spilled drinks again!

What's the trick to removing the stocker? Felt like I was going to break it.
I opened the console lid, then on the edge of the cupholder (where the forward edge of the console ends in the pics above), pull out (to the driver or passenger door depending on what side you are pulling) and up slightly...you should hear a pop...then pull the back edge of the cup holder on that same side.
They are held on by little tabs that grip the outside of the console, so if you can visualize 2 square holes on either side of the cupholder, you need to flex the cupholder "out" to get those tabs out of the holes.
